Hello, is it possible to get into a university in England or Ireland without taking the GCSE's, do they accept SAT scores?
It is possible to gain admission to universities in the UK and Ireland without GCSEs, as institutions often accept alternative qualifications, including SAT scores. Universities prioritize fulfilling minimum entry requirements, and many foreign students are welcomed based on their local qualifications. The University of Oxford provides specific guidelines for international qualifications, which can be found on their official admissions page.
